The Ndorobo people,whose name is “Musopisiek” means “People of the mountains”,have lived for generations on the slopes of Mount Elgon, maintaining a strong bond with nature,traditions and ancestral rich history.

What You Will Experience

During the Ndorobo trail cultural adventure, you will walk alongside local guides who knows all the trails and the roots of the culture and the best scenic spots. The journey introduces you to daily life in the mountains,where families depend on small scale farming,traditional medicine and basket weaving for their livelihoods.

As you move along the trail, you will learn about indigenous crops, food, local medicine using sustainable methods. Discover Sipi Falls guide will explain how the community protects water sources, moorlands and the wildlife from Mount Elgon while practicing to farm responsibly. You will discover local plants and medicinal herbs that have been used for generations.

The walk is interactive and personal,allowing visitors to stop at homesteads,interact with the families and listen to the stories that reflect the community’s history and values.

Cultural Activities and Ndorobo´s Traditional Values

A key part of the Ndorobo experiences are basket weaving,handcraft making,local food preparations using farm harvests,landscapes and waterfalls with stunning views of Mount Elgon moorlands.

One of the most special part of the experience is child naming ceremonies and family rituals in caves through storytelling and demonstrations, you will explore how these ceremonies strengthen Ndorobo’s identity, spirituality and norms.

Local singing,oral traditions and local elderly ndorobos interact with the visitors during the walk giving you deeper insight into the Ndorobo livelihood and their relationship with the mountains.

Nature, Waterfalls and Scenic Views of the Ndorobo Trail

The cultural trail is set in a beautiful environment that enhances the experience. The trail passes through green hills, shaded mount Elgon forest and open viewpoints overlooking the flat plains of Karamoja region. Along the trails, you may encounter bird species,butterflies, hidden waterfalls and blue monkeys.

Frequently Asked Questions about the Ndorobo Nature Trail

The Ndorobo Nature Trail is a cultural and nature walk that introduces visitors to the Musopisiek community and the landscapes surrounding Mount Elgon.

The trail is located in Kapchorwa- Kween District in eastern Uganda on the slopes of Mount Elgon.

Visitors can explore traditional villages, learn about local culture, and enjoy scenic views of the surrounding landscapes.
